Intense monsoon rainfall has triggered widespread disruption across the Kashmir Valley, causing significant damage to agricultural yields and critical infrastructure. The surge in precipitation has led to the submergence of vast tracts of farmland and the flooding of undulating terrains, effectively halting daily commerce and routine activities in several districts. The current crisis underscores a deepening vulnerability in the region’s ability to manage extreme weather events, threatening the immediate livelihoods of thousands of farmers and the broader food security of the valley.

The onset of heavy monsoon rains has transformed the valley’s geography into a series of flood zones. In low-lying and undulating areas, water bodies have swollen beyond their capacities, spilling into residential zones and agricultural fields. Local reports indicate that the volume of precipitation has overwhelmed existing drainage systems, leading to stagnant water in urban centers and rapid runoff in rural highlands.

The agricultural sector, which serves as the economic backbone for a significant portion of the Kashmiri population, has borne the brunt of the weather. Crops essential for local consumption and trade have been submerged under rising water levels. For many farmers, the timing of this rainfall is catastrophic, as it coincides with critical growth stages for various seasonal harvests. The saturation of the soil not only destroys current crops but also risks long-term soil degradation and the introduction of water-borne crop diseases.

Beyond the fields, the physical infrastructure of the region has suffered structural failures. Reports from the affected areas describe buildings with compromised foundations and roads rendered impassable by landslides or deep flooding. The disruption has extended to the transport network, grinding the movement of goods and people to a halt, which in turn has spiked the cost of essential commodities in local markets.

Analysis:
The recurring nature of these disruptions suggests that the Kashmir Valley is facing a systemic failure in climate resilience. The undulating geography of the region naturally accelerates runoff, but when combined with intensifying monsoon patterns, this creates a “funnel effect” where low-lying areas are disproportionately devastated. The fact that routine daily activities can be brought to a complete standstill by a single weather event points to a critical lack of investment in climate-adaptive infrastructure.

From an economic perspective, the submergence of crops represents more than a seasonal loss; it is a manifestation of food insecurity. When local agricultural stability is compromised, the region becomes more dependent on external supply chains, increasing vulnerability to price volatility. The inability of current drainage systems to handle the volume of precipitation indicates that the infrastructure was designed for historical weather norms that no longer apply in the current climatic era.

The vulnerability of the region is further compounded by the intersection of geography and governance. In undulating terrains, the lack of integrated watershed management means that water is not diverted or stored effectively, but instead allowed to flow destructively. This suggests a need for a shift from reactive disaster management—such as emergency relief—to proactive structural engineering and sustainable land-use planning.

The context of this upheaval is rooted in the broader trend of erratic monsoon behavior across South Asia. The Kashmir Valley, while distinct in its topography, is not immune to the shifting precipitation patterns seen across the subcontinent. Historically, the region has dealt with seasonal rains, but the intensity and concentration of rainfall in recent years have increased.

Agriculture in Kashmir is characterized by a mix of subsistence farming and high-value cash crops, including saffron and various fruits. The loss of these crops does not just impact the current fiscal year but can damage the perennial plants that take years to mature. Furthermore, the region’s reliance on traditional farming methods, while culturally significant, often lacks the technical safeguards—such as advanced irrigation and drainage—necessary to withstand flash flooding.

The structural damage noted in recent reports is also a reflection of the region’s construction history. Many buildings in the valley were constructed without stringent adherence to flood-resistant architecture, leaving them susceptible to the hydrostatic pressure exerted by rising groundwater and saturated soil.

As the valley begins the process of recovery, several key indicators will determine the long-term impact of this event. First, the extent of the crop loss will need to be quantified through official assessments to determine if government compensation packages are sufficient to prevent a cycle of debt for small-scale farmers.

Second, the response of the administration regarding infrastructure repair will be critical. Whether the government opts for simple repairs or implements comprehensive drainage overhauls will signal the level of commitment to long-term resilience. Observers will be watching for the introduction of “sponge city” concepts or improved watershed management strategies that could mitigate future runoff.

Third, the impact on the local economy will be monitored. If the disruption to transport and commerce persists, it may lead to a prolonged economic slump in the region, affecting everything from artisanal crafts to the tourism sector.

The current upheaval in the Kashmir Valley serves as a stark reminder of the fragility of human settlements in the face of environmental volatility. While the immediate focus remains on relief and restoration, the event highlights a fundamental gap between the region’s environmental risks and its structural readiness. Without a transition toward evidence-based, climate-resilient planning, the undulating valley will likely remain trapped in a cycle of seasonal devastation, where each monsoon brings a renewed threat to the livelihoods and stability of its people.
